MINUTES — MANAGEMENT MEETING

The team reviewed the term sheet from Corvane Holdings. Key points: a convertible instrument, a valuation cap the group considers low, and a board observer seat. Finance will model dilution scenarios by Thursday. Legal flagged the exclusivity clause for renegotiation. A counterproposal goes out next week. Strategic context is provided in the confidential note below.

board note of kageg-bahof: The renewal with Holwynax Holdings closes at $2 million a year, 5 percent below the last contract. Project Ulaath slips by two quarters because of the supplier delay.

## Service accounts — Fielddrift offline mode

Offline mode in the Fielddrift survey app syncs cached observations through the internal Caravanserai relay once connectivity returns. Sync runs under a dedicated service account, not the user's session, so review any change to the sync worker carefully. The account has write access to the staging observation store only. Rotation is quarterly; do not reuse the account elsewhere. The relay requires the service account's key on every sync request, and the current key is listed below.

gateway credential: kto3_qfe

### Runbook: ReceiptRelay mailer stuck

Symptoms: donation receipts queueing, no sends, queue depth alert fires.

First: check the SMTP relay health endpoint. If healthy, the mailer worker is probably wedged on a malformed template — restart the worker pool, not the whole service. If unhealthy, fail over to the secondary relay and page the infra rotation. Do not replay the dead-letter queue until dedupe is confirmed on, or donors get duplicate receipts. Verify the service is running with the following configuration values.

config for kajeg-bafop:
[julael]
host = julael.plorvadata.corp
user = julael_svc
database = julael_prod